The Powerball lottery is a popular game in the United States. It's played in 45 states, as well as the District of Columbia, Puerto Rico, and the U. S. Virgin Islands. The game is drawn twice a week, on Wednesdays and Saturdays. Players pick five numbers from 1 to 69, and one Powerball number from 1 to 26. The jackpot starts at $20 million and grows with each drawing until there is a winner. The Power Play option, which multiplies non-jackpot prizes, adds an extra layer of excitement to the game.
